Problem with Near Real-Time Status of ecobee3 equipment

I am having partial success getting near real-time status of my ecobee3 by running an Indigo Schedule every 5 seconds that asks for a "Get All Status (Thermostat Controls)".

The cool and hot setpoints get updated in Indigo as soon as the schedule runs, but the status of my equipment takes forever (usually in minutes), which makes me think only some of the data is available on a device status request, but not sure if that is an ecobee3 limitation or a possibly issue with the Indigo plugin.

If you are curious, what I am trying to do is when the Fan equipment becomes ON (and noisy), increase my Yamaha receiver volume, and when OFF, decrease the volume.

Re: Problem with Near Real-Time Status of ecobee3 equipment

I suspect that your thermostats are not sending updates to the Ecobee servers as often as you would like. The plugin is getting all data from the cloud servers. not from the thermostats.

Also, you're about to get locked out of your Ecobee account. You're limited to 85,000 queries a month, and at 12/minute you're going to do in excess of 500,000 for the month.

Put an energy meter on the circuit feeding the air handler. Use that to control your volume.

Re: Problem with Near Real-Time Status of ecobee3 equipment

OK, I wasn't sure if all the data was coming from the Cloud, but now that you have confirmed it, I just put an energy meter on the air handler, and it works great.

And I went back to every 1 minute schedule instead of 5 seconds.

It is just weird that the setpoint values are apparently updated every few seconds, but things like equipment status much less so.
